AI Infrastructure: The New Frontier in Wealth Management
Noah Holdings Limited, widely recognized for its expertise in wealth management, has recently published its H1 2026 CIO Report, titled "Global Wealth Reshaped in the Age of AI: Growth, Allocation, and Legacy." This report highlights the evolving landscape of wealth management as artificial intelligence (AI) emerges as a significant infrastructure asset class, transforming traditional views on investment strategies.
The Shift in Wealth Management Strategies
The report emphasizes a critical paradigm shift in wealth management, where the focus is transitioning from short-term gains towards long-term stability. AI is moving beyond mere software innovations into an essential component of wealth infrastructure. As macroeconomic uncertainties persist, the idea of safeguarding wealth has become paramount, with growing attention on assets that provide reliable, long-term returns.

The Role of AI Infrastructure
AI's potential in wealth management is particularly exciting when viewed through the lens of infrastructure. The report argues that investments should not solely focus on software or stock performance but on real-world infrastructure like data centers and energy systems. By investing in AI infrastructure, families can anchor their portfolios against market volatility and ensure steady cash flows over extended periods. This strategic approach will help them manage the upcoming wave of AI-driven demands on energy and digital infrastructure.
A Structured Approach to Asset Allocation
The report proposes a three-layer framework for effective asset allocation that incorporates: core long-term assets with robust cash flows, liquidity management strategies, and structures designed to foster continuity across generations. This framework underlines the importance of consideration for both current market conditions and future uncertainties.

About Noah Holdings
Noah Holdings Limited (NYSE: NOAH; HKEX: 6686) is a notable name in global wealth management, dedicated to supporting Chinese families worldwide. Having been publicly traded since 2010, the firm continues to build its reputation as a trusted partner across generations. With over two decades of expertise, Noah’s integrated global approach includes four booking centers positioned strategically across Asia and North America.
